Output 18eccabca63b1805456e6f4b2391adccbf5f1a449771d1e0f884047ca9105dbd:2
- value
- 17580000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7d810795dc4ef0ee80d35551b83d09941e1e649b OP_EQUAL
- address
- 3D8cxf9Gu65QeeCPECDnzgSdUGEa1osiAp
- transaction
- 18eccabca63b1805456e6f4b2391adccbf5f1a449771d1e0f884047ca9105dbd
- confirmations
- 312559
- spent
- true